While the holiday season is a time of generosity and thankfulness spent with family and friends, it can also be a source of stress, burnout, and loss of focus, writes James C. Price for Refresh Leadership, a blog of Express Employment Professionals.

Several strategies can help you maintain focus during the holidays and end the year strong.

As December is one of the busiest times of the year, be sure to maintain a healthy work/life balance by taking a vacation day before the holidays hit. Taking a day in the middle of the month can be less taxing on your co-workers and will help you cross some major items off your to-do list.

Since this is an extremely busy time at work, it usually requires all hands on deck. So it is important to work on time management with everybody, as well as delegating tasks when needed.

Finally, it is important to be realistic about what can be accomplished during this period to avoid end-of-the-year burnout. Evaluate the most important achievements your team should focus on and separate them from the tasks that are nice-to-haves but not necessarily imperative to your organization’s success.
